NaMeX - Nautilus Mediterranean EXchange Point Namex Rome is a data center located at 6b Via Dei Tizii in Rome, Italy. This facility, owned by NaMeX - Nautilus Mediterranean EXchange Point, provides digital infrastructure for the Rome market. It supports colocation deployments and a range of private connectivity options for businesses.
Buyers can secure colocation through locking cabinets and private cages within the NaMeX - Nautilus Mediterranean EXchange Point Namex Rome data center. The site also offers Ethernet Private Line and wavelength services, enabling point-to-point private connectivity. These high-capacity links are available through providers such as EXA Infrastructure.
